So What Should You Actually Be Looking For?

If you're planning your next offsite, conference, or team day, it's worth asking a few questions before you book anywhere:

  • How large is the space outdoors? 

  • Is the venue flexible enough for both structured sessions and informal downtime?

  • Is there venue support on the day, or are you left to manage all the suppliers?

  • What happens if it rains? (This is England, after all)

  • Is the venue somewhere your team will actually remember, not just another conference room?

  • Does the venue's approach to sustainability match your company's own values?
